A former Manchester City star has revealed a shocking decision influenced by Pep Guardiola's training methods. Han Willhoft-King, once a promising Premier League player, decided to leave professional football at 19 to study law at Oxford University. Willhoft-King's story highlights the psychological challenges young athletes face, where intense training sessions can impact their enjoyment and long-term goals.

The Rise and Sudden End

Willhoft-King's decision to leave football was unexpected, given his promising career trajectory. He progressed through Tottenham Hotspur's academy and joined Manchester City's Under-21s, coached by Yaya Toure. However, his journey was riddled with injuries and a lack of consistent playing time, leaving him frustrated and questioning his future in football.

The Impact of Guardiola's Training

In an interview with The Telegraph, Willhoft-King described Guardiola's training sessions as intense and mentally challenging. He noted the high-pressure environment, where players like De Bruyne and Haaland were treated as normal individuals, despite their stardom. The training sessions involved relentless pressing and running, which Willhoft-King found unappealing, stating, 'It’s not a very pleasant experience.'

A Different Path

Willhoft-King's decision to leave football was influenced by his desire for a more fulfilling future. He excelled academically, achieving A* grades while balancing A-levels with football. His family's academic background and his own intellectual curiosity led him to choose Oxford University, where he studies law and continues to play football at a recreational level.
